Suzanne Renner in Podcasts
personSuzanne Renner, a scientist at Washington University in St. Louis, who studies plant protection mechanisms.
Mentions Over Time
1
mentions
1
related entities
Related Entities
Mentions in Podcasts
Short Wave
Fall foliage is still a mystery: Why do some leaves turn red?
I was talking to Suzanne Renner at Washington University in St.